The President or appropriate designee, is authorized to execute
on behalf of the Village and file with the FCC such certification
forms or other instruments as are now or may hereafter be required
by the FCC Rate regulations in order to enable the Village to regulate
Basic Service Rates and Charges.

The President and the Board of Trustees of the Village may order
the cable operator to refund to subscribers a portion of previously
paid rates under the following circumstances:
A. A portion of the previously paid rates have been determined to be
in excess of the permitted basic cable service tier charge or above
the actual cost of equipment; or
B. The cable operator has failed to comply with a valid rate order issued
by the Village.

Failure by the cable operator to comply with the terms and conditions
established by this article shall constitute a violation of the Cable
Television Franchise Ordinance originally enacted by the Board of
Trustees as amended and extended. Penalties for such violation are
subject to the provisions of the Municipal Code of the Village of
Thornton.
